Monthly Cost of Living
😐A single person spends $2,979 per month in Nuuk vs $1,641 in Medellin, rent included.
😐A couple spends around $4,468 per month in Nuuk vs $2,447 in Medellin, rent included.
😐A family of three spends $5,957 per month in Nuuk vs $3,253 in Medellin, rent included.
😐Nuuk costs about 82% more than Medellin, driven mainly by Groceries & Markets.
📊Both Nuuk and Medellin sit above the global median – Nuuk by 116%, Medellin by 19%.

Cost Breakdown
🏠A central one-bedroom costs $1,619 in Nuuk versus $1,071 in Medellin. Rent is usually the largest line item in a monthly budget, so the gap here sets the tone for the overall comparison.
💰Salaries run about 716% higher in Nuuk, which partly offsets the higher cost of living there. Purchasing power depends on which expenses matter most to you.
🛒A mid-range dinner for two costs $111 in Nuuk versus $48.00 in Medellin. Monthly groceries follow the same trend: $634 vs $300 – making Medellin the more affordable choice for daily food spending.
